AmeriHealth Caritas Family of Companies ( AmeriHealth Caritas ), a national leader in Medicaid managed care and other integrated health care solutions for those most in need announced today that its Louisiana Medicaid plan, AmeriHealth Caritas Louisiana , has been notified by the Louisiana Department of Health of its intent to award it a contract to continue serving its Medicaid managed care program.

  • AmeriHealth Caritas Louisiana has been part of Healthy Louisiana, the states managed care program, since its launch in 2011 and currently serves approximately 200,000 members.
  • AmeriHealth Caritas Louisiana is one of five Medicaid managed care plans that participate in the Healthy Louisiana program.
  • Headquartered in Philadelphia, AmeriHealth Caritas is a mission-driven organization with more than 35 years of experience serving low-income and chronically ill populations.

OAKLAND, Calif., July 29, 2019 /PRNewswire/ -- Kaiser Permanente announced today that Mike Ramseier is the new regional president for Kaiser Permanente in Colorado.

  • In his role, Ramseier will lead all health care and health plan operations for Kaiser Permanente Colorado, which as the state's largest nonprofit health plan provides care for more than 640,000 members.
  • Ramseier has deep experience in Colorado, having served as president of Anthem Blue Cross and Blue Shield in Colorado from 2011 to 2017.
  • Ramseier will report directly to Gregory A. Adams, executive vice president and group president, Kaiser Foundation Health Plan, Inc. and Hospitals.
